Soon Jung Hwang is a pioneering researcher in the field of maxillofacial surgery, with a primary focus on the integration of robotics and image-guided navigation to enhance surgical precision. Her major contributions lie in developing autonomous and semi-autonomous robotic systems for complex craniofacial procedures, particularly orthognathic surgery. Notably, her 2021 study on robot-assisted maxillary positioning demonstrated a novel method to reduce intraoperative errors, achieving 27 citations and highlighting a shift away from time-consuming laboratory processes. She further advanced the field with a 2021 phantom mandible trial, where an autonomous robot osteotomy for bone harvesting showed superior accuracy over manual techniques—a key step toward clinical adoption. Her 2020 work on a robot arm and navigation-assisted system for maxillary repositioning, with 8 citations, introduced a simplified, safe approach using real-time imaging to guide bone segment alignment. Hwang’s research directly addresses the critical challenge of minimizing human error in delicate facial reconstructions, and her work is widely recognized for its potential to transform surgical workflows, making complex procedures more predictable and less invasive.
